My (3yo) daughter has been thriving at Valley Christian Academy! The teachers and staff are dedicated to providing a Christ centered education through fun and meaningful classroom experiences. At VCA the children are assessed on their large and fine motor skills as well as other cognitive development, VCA offers a reading academy and they hold an annual school play that is absolutely adorable!!

My daughter is currently attending kindergarten at VCA. Whatever youre looking for in a good elementary school, this school has it. Academics are solid, I am amazed at how well her reading has improved and more importantly she is excited to show off her new literacy skills. The school focuses on a childs individual needs and level and has a great teacher to student ratio so each child has an opportunity to learn to the best of his or her ability. The school offers sports opportunities, before and after school care, basically everything youd want in a school. But more importantly to our family is that our daughter loves it.Have a positive school experience early on can set the stage for a childs entire education. It was more important to us because our daughter is on the high functioning end of the autism spectrum and we know how frustrating traditional school environments can be for students like her. She is excited to go to school every morning. She loves her friends and her teachers. And the great thing for me as a parent, I know the teachers love her back and really care about her, Im sending her to a school that celebrates her for who she is. Theyve worked hard with her to help her develop the social skills she needs to get a solid footing in school.If youre considering a private, Christian, education for your child, if you want a strong academic focus in a caring environment, I would highly recommend Valley Christian.

A Rainbow of Friends Preschool and Kindergarten is a wonderful, nurturing school. My daughter has attended this school for three years now. Ive had friends who are not even connected to the school comment on how advanced my daughter is with writing, reading, and her interaction skills. The school uses a direct teaching style that captures the attention of young students, and keeps them engaged in the learning process. The first few years are extremely crucial for children. If they do not have a solid foundation in preschool, kindergarten and 1st grade, the tendency to fall behind carries on through later years. I feel my daughter has a great start thanks to Renee and her staff at A Rainbow of Friends, and I have every confidence shell excel in the years to come.As for Renee, she is a very competent and professional teacher and director. If you can fault her in anything, its that she cares too much. She takes her job very seriously and cares deeply about the success and well being of not only her students, but her staff and parents as well. She has parent meetings and invites parents to attend several functions throughout the year. She has her teachers provide extensive feedback on each child during parent/teacher conferences. In fact, I was shocked at the amount of topics/learning points that each teacher was able to speak to regarding my daughters progress. I remember thinking, its amazing they have this much detail, and its only preschool. I was very impressed and was able to use the information provided to help my daughter with areas of opportunity at home.
